How they compare
Italy currently reports 12.99 against 11.68 in Netherlands, a difference of 1.31.
That makes Italy's figure about 1.1 times Netherlands's.
The two have swapped places 3 times across 25 shared years of data; in 2000 it was Netherlands ahead.
Italy ranks 12th and Netherlands ranks 14th of 154 countries.
Italy has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Italy | Netherlands |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 1.85 | 1.25 | 0.5961 | Italy |
| 2010s | 8.72 | 3.33 | 5.39 | Italy |
| 2020s | 11.85 | 9.08 | 2.77 | Italy |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
